removing the stock licp was simple...installing the new one was a chore. the hardest part was plotting out the correct way to couple the pipes to get the cleanest flow without effing the couplers. took us a few minutes but once we held the stocker up there we were able to mock it out and bolt it right up. the i/c and lower i/c pipes are the xs power pieces sold on ebay that have had great results for our car. couldn't justify spending $ for the ams/buschur units when this one flowed just as well and made just as much power. if you do a search on evom for the author 4tun8 you can see all the different tests done. pretty cool stuff. and can't beat $200 shipped through a group buy on evom.

i believe its an XS POWER intercooler setup.. there was no flange, just new pipe routing. install was pretty straight forward and simple with the exception of having to trim the undertray to clear the new intercooler. sucks bout the timing chain cover though.. they sent him the carbon fiber timing chain cover for the evo8, NOT the 9 which needs a relief to clear the mivec setup on the intake cam gear. she needs a bath but looks good.
